The profiles are listed in priority order for use by the automatic roaming feature. Change the order by moving
profiles up or down. To edit existing profiles, tap and hold one in the list and select an option from the menu to
connect, edit, disable (enable), or delete the profile. (Note that the Disable menu item changes to Enable if the
profile is already disabled.)
